Looking for an anniversary gift for my husband. He really likes documentary film making.

For your husband who enjoys documentary filmmaking, there are several meaningful and personal gift ideas that you can consider for your anniversary. These options will not only show your thoughtfulness but also encourage his passion for filmmaking.

1. Documentary Film Equipment: To support his hobby, consider gifting him a new piece of documentary film equipment. It could be a high-quality camera, a professional microphone, or even a stabilization device like a gimbal. Such an investment will not only enhance his documentary filmmaking skills but also serve as a constant reminder of your support for his passion.

2. Books on Documentary Filmmaking: Expand his knowledge and inspire new ideas by selecting books that delve into the art of documentary filmmaking. Look for titles that focus on different aspects like storytelling techniques, cinematography, editing, or interviews. This gift will not only provide him with valuable insights but also serve as a source of inspiration for future projects.

3. Subscription to a Documentary Streaming Service: Consider gifting him a subscription to a popular documentary streaming service like Netflix, Hulu, or Amazon Prime Video. With access to a wide range of documentaries, he will have unlimited content to explore and get inspired by. This gift allows him to watch award-winning documentaries, discover new filmmakers, and deepen his understanding of the craft.

4. Documentary Filmmaking Course or Workshop: Help him expand and refine his documentary filmmaking skills by enrolling him in a documentary filmmaking course or workshop. Look for local options in your area or even online courses offered by renowned filmmakers. This experience will provide him with valuable knowledge, practical tips, and the opportunity to network with other enthusiasts.

5. Customized Gear or Accessories: Consider getting him personalized gear or accessories related to his love for documentary filmmaking. Ideas include a custom camera strap engraved with his initials, a personalized director's clapboard, or a t-shirt with a design related to iconic documentary films or quotes. These personalized items will make him feel extra special and demonstrate your understanding of his passion.

6. Film Festival Pass: If there's a documentary film festival happening in your area or a nearby city, surprise him with a pass. This will give him the chance to watch a curated selection of documentary films, attend Q&A sessions with filmmakers, and immerse himself in the world of documentary filmmaking. It's a fantastic opportunity to be part of a community that shares his passion.

Remember to consider your husband's specific interests within documentary filmmaking when selecting a gift. Whether it's a focus on social issues, nature, or historical events, tailor your gift to his preferences to make it even more thoughtful and personal. By acknowledging and supporting his passion for documentary filmmaking, you're showing him how much you value his interests and dreams.
